Number of people living in cities, towns and rural areas in French Guiana
French Guiana: Number of people living in cities, towns and rural areas was 86,550 people in 2020. ◆ Volatile
Number of people living in cities, towns and rural areas in French Guiana, 1950–2020
Source: European Commission, Joint Research Centre (JRC) (2025) – with major processing by Our World in Data. Measured in people.
Analysis
In 2020, number of people living in cities, towns and rural areas in French Guiana stood at 86,550 people. That is the highest value across all 15 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 7.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, number of people living in cities, towns and rural areas in French Guiana peaked at 86,550 people in 2020 and was at its lowest, 12,559 people, in 1950.
French Guiana ranks 177th of 236 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
Estimated number of people living in rural areas. Rural areas are identified using satellite imagery and population data, applying the same definitions across countries.
